Addison stopped at the traffic light. She wasn't really allowed to be driving and she knew that if Daniel found out he'd be pissed. But, she wasn't comfortable having to always call the driver to take her to the company so that she could see Emily today so she was driving herself home.

The light turned green. She had barely mastered the roads and turns of this city and was finding it quite difficult to navigate around. She was about to make a turn when a car sped past her, startling her. Suddenly, she felt a sharp pain in her head and saw herself in a car crashing into another, she saw the glass shattering and felt the vivid impact of the collision.

Suddenly it disappeared and she was back on the road, she hurriedly parked her car at the side of the road, feeling overwhelmed.

'What was that? Could it be a flashback?' She thought.

* * *

Knock knock knock

Addison opened the door to her bedroom. It was Daniel.

"Were you asleep?" He asked quietly, as though he were sneaking around. She smiled.

"No" she returned in his tone.

"Would you like to join me tonight?" He asked, smiling as innocently as a child would.

She laughed quietly "Why are you speaking like that?"

"I don't know" he replied, still smiling as he held her hand in his.

"Yes, I would like that," she replied and they made their way to his bedroom.

"Did you miss me today?" She asked as they lay on the bed.

"Yea" he looked at her dreamily.

"Stop looking at me like that, would you?"

"No," he smiled.

"Can I make a silly confession?" She asked.

"Yes"

"I hate having dinner without you there, it feels lonely." She complained. "And I hate having you gone the whole day only to get back when I'm already asleep."

He was quiet for a while before he responded. "You've really changed a lot, Amelia" he was still smiling. "You used to rejoice in my absence"

Addison laughed, "really?"

"Yea… it's weird now." He answered "Not just that, you're like a totally different person. Everyone at work says so too"

"Like a better person?" She asked, already knowing the answer. He nodded as his ridiculous smile grew bigger.

"You're also a totally different person than you are at work" she added and he laughed.

"I'll start leaving work earlier" he abruptly said "At least before dinner time"

Her eyes gleamed for joy. "Thank you" she said, beaming.

"Oh yes, that's right!" She interjected, "Have I ever been in a car crash before?"

"No. Why?" Daniel answered, confused.

"Nevermind"

'That means it wasn't a flashback after all' 'So what was it then?' she thought.

* * *

"Do you know where my husband is?" Addison asked James, she had met him at the office but Daniel wasn't around.

"He left the office with some of the board members, they're at the other departments supervising activities" he stated in one breath.

"Alright. I'll just take a mini tour then." she said and gave him the eye when he tried standing up to accompany her.

She pressed the open button of the elevator and the doors opened to reveal a tall blonde in a swimsuit.

She smiled brightly as she saw him.

"Wowwww!" He exclaimed in surprise. "What a pleasant surprise!"

"I know right" she said as she got in.

"How come you're always alone?"

"I like moving alone"

"Isn't your husband scared that someone's gonna harm you or something?"

"Something like what?"

"Like snatch you away from him" he looked at her and she laughed.

"You're an idiot"

"And you're weird now"

"What do you mean?"

"You were always isolated before, what changed?"

"Really?"

"You would always act like all the other workers were beneath you and they said you hated coming to the company" he added.

"I did?"

"Yea"

"Well I lost my memory, so…"

"That doesn't affect one's attitude though"

"...well, I guess so"

The elevator got to the 8th floor.

"My stop." She said.

"Same" he said as they walked out together. Suddenly someone rushed past her causing her to stumble and fall to the floor.

"I'm so sorry" the lady apologized.

That sharp pain in her head was back, she winced in pain and opened her eyes to see herself being pushed to the ground. She could feel the sand against her palms even.

"I'll make sure you pay for everything you've done to my family, Addison" she heard the angry voice of a lady. The image flashed through her head, the raven-black hair, the emerald-green eyes, the smug smile. Emily!!

"Hey, are you alright?" Jared asked as he held her.

The image disappeared suddenly and she was met with the worried gaze of a blue eyed blonde. "I'm fine," she replied, panting.

"Are you sure?"

She wasn't, what on earth was that?

It wasn't a hallucination as she had thought, it was a vivid flashback. She was terrified.

"Jared" she looked at him "I think I should get going now". She didn't let him reply before she turned and went back into the elevator.

Addison had a lot of questions. Her thoughts were running wild.

'Why did she remember Emily?'

'Was she referring to her as Addison?'

'How about the car crash? Was that a flashback also?'

While they were seated for dinner, she asked Daniel:

"Do you know…of any Addison?"

"Addison?" He repeated.

"Yes…Addison" she confirmed, her voice slightly shaky. She was still very much terrible and uncontrollably eager to find out what was going on in her head.

"No" he shook his head. "I've never heard of an Addison, why do you ask?"

"It's nothing important" she lied.

"It doesn't seem so," he said, frowning in worry.

She faked a smile. "It's nothing really, if it was you'd know"

"You seem…troubled tonight"

"I'm not troubled, it's just…cramps" she lied.

"Oh…" he started.

"I'd like to sleep in my bedroom tonight, is that okay with you?" She interrupted.

"Y…yea"

She needed to be alone tonight. Her own mind was driving her crazy. She needed to recollect her memories tonight.

She sat upright in her room with her eyes closed for hours that night. Picturing and focusing strictly on everything she had managed to recall from her past. The environment, the scent, the feeling,...the misery.

The first thing she could recall was the misery, she felt it pierce into her heart like a dagger for minutes before the pictures aligned.

"Addison"

"Addison"

"Addison"

She had continued to hear. She felt the warm tears streaming down her eyes like a river but she held her eyes shut. She recalled her childhood, her struggle, her relationships, her pain, her joys, her misery. She remembered everything.

Once she had opened her eyes, she found herself on the marble floor, her face was drenched in tears.

'Who the hell was she? And how did she end up here?'
